Volunteers Needed to Clean/Prepare Native Prairie Seeds

Join us to help rebuild more tallgrass prairie by cleaning native prairie seed by hand and with tools at Neal Smith National Wildlife Refuge on Saturday, February 10, 2024, from 9:00 am – 12:00 pm. This process involves removing the stem, leaves, and other parts, leaving just the seeds for planting. This effort will help reconstruct diverse tallgrass prairie. Work will be done inside the seed lab located at the visitor center. You can enjoy learning about prairie plants while contributing to building prairie for people and wildlife.
